SHOW HALL: Westmoreland County Community College 145 Pavilion Lane, Youngwood PA 15697 Ph: 724-925-4000. The show Hall is heated or air conditioned, as needed. This is a non smoking hall. The western Pennsylvania Cat Fanciers and the Westmoreland County Community College will not be responsible for lost or damage to personal property. People food is available on site.
ENTRIES: Make Checks Payable to: Western Pennsylvania Cat Fanciers (US Funds only). All fees must accompany entries. No post dated checks will be accepted. A $35.00 fee will be charged for each returned check. Any returned checks must be covered by a Money Order or cash. Please type or print legibly. Collect calls will be made in the event an entry is illegible or incomplete. NO SALES CAGES PERMITTED WITHOUT AN ENTRY. Benching requests will be honored only for those who enter both shows.
CHECK-IN: All cats must be checked in between 7–8:30 AM each day. Judging will begin at 9 AM on Saturday and 9 AM on Sunday. Advertised show hours are 9-5 on Saturday and 9-5 on Sunday.
RULES: CFA Show Rules will be strictly enforced. Current A copy of the current CFA show rules may be obtained by sending $7 to Cat Fanciers' Association, 260 E. Main St. Alliance, OH 44601 or online.
NON-VETTED SHOW: All cats should be free of fleas, fungus, ear mites or contagious diseases. Any entry suspected of having any of these will be removed from the show hall until it can pass a veterinary inspection. All claws must be clipped. You are advised to have all cats and kittens inoculated for Feline Enteritis, Rhinotracheitis and Calicivirus and tested for FeLV prior to entry.
SUPPLIES: Cat litter will be available. Please provide your own cat food, dishes and litter pans. Benching cages are 22x22x22".
AWARDS: Rosettes will be offered in all rings for Final Awards. We will be using permanent ribbons where applicable, but cloth ribbons will be available for those who desire them. All championship, premiership and kitten entries with registration numbers or temporary registration numbers will be scored for CFA National and Regional points. Owners of novices can contact the entry clerk for a temporary registration number. Kittens without registration numbers may be shown but will not be scored.
NOVICE EXHIBITORS: Bring a towel or rug for the floor of the cage and enough fabric to go around 3 sides and cover the top. Secure with clips or pins. All cats must be brought in a carrier.
